• DocumentCode
    2812958
  • Title

    A Structured Template for an Effcient Dependable System Design Using Model Driven Architecture and Spin Tool

  • Author

    Kaliappan, Vishnu Kumar ; Kaliappan, P.S. ; Quy, N.X. ; Duckwon, Quy ; Min, Dugki ; Choi, Eunmi

  • Author_Institution
    Dept. of Inf. & Commun. Eng., Konkuk Univ., Seoul
  • fYear
    2008
  • fDate
    28-30 Aug. 2008
  • Firstpage
    126
  • Lastpage
    132
  • Abstract
    Dependability is one of the critical system level issues in protocol design and it is not efficiently solved today. The main factor in this issue is the lack of design/modeling specifications with proper semantics. Most of the design specifications capture either hardware or software entities. In order to solve this problem we propose an architecture template for designing dependable systems. Our approach uses the model driven architecture as the base and it is redesigned by addressing the properties of dependability. More preciously, the verification and validation tools are incorporated in the design phase, which enables the development to be stable at any cost of time. In order to test the efficiency of the template, the example data transfer protocol (protocol used for data transfer over an unreliable media) is analyzed and implemented with the template. The spin plug-in tool is used in the proposed template to verify the design level test results. Our test results impress the designer to verify the expected results with the system design and to identify the errors which are unnoticed during the design phase.
  • Keywords
    design; formal specification; program verification; protocols; software architecture; software reliability; data transfer protocol; dependable system design; design specifications; hardware entities; model driven architecture; modeling specifications; protocol design; software entities; spin plug-in tool; spin tool; structured template; validation tools; verification tools; Business communication; Computer architecture; Computer networks; Design engineering; Hardware; Information technology; Protocols; Specification languages; Testing; Unified modeling language;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Convergence and Hybrid Information Technology, 2008. ICHIT '08. International Conference on
  • Conference_Location
    Daejeon
  • Print_ISBN
    978-0-7695-3328-5
  • Type

    conf

  • DOI
    10.1109/ICHIT.2008.264
  • Filename
    4622812